Resize Columns in Excel Quickly With AutoFit
When working with spreadsheets in Excel, you often need to resize columns to fit the content within. Manually adjusting each column can be a tedious process, but luckily there's a quick solution: AutoFit. This convenient feature automatically measures the ideal width for each column based on the longest entry within it.
To use AutoFit, simply right-click on the top row and select "AutoFit Column Width". This will instantly expand the column to comfortably display all the values. You can also apply AutoFit to multiple columns at once by selecting them before right-clicking.
